The Location of the Zion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Zion Cemetery:
40.6983, -89.4643
The Zion Cemetery is located in Tazewell County<1>.
The county seat for Tazewell County is located in Pekin. Pekin lies 12 miles [19.3 km]<2> to the southwest of the Zion Cemetery .

Name Variations for Zion Cemetery ...
When doing your research, keep in mind that names and their spelling can change over time. Various errors happen - anything from simple spelling to bad translations.
Zion Cemetery has also been known as:
- Zion Lutheran Cemetery
- Cedar Cemetery

- Referenced GNIS Record ...
- GNIS ID #1747481 (Zion Lutheran Cemetery)
-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#1747481 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Tazewell
- Est. Elev: 244 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: Washington
- Location given for Zion Lutheran Cemetery:
- Lat: 40.6983708 Lon: -89.4642591
